  • Re: flying with a 15-month old

    Things that kept my 15-month old occupied on flights: 1. An etch-a-sketch 2. books 3. Coloring books and crayons 4. Snacks - raisins, cheerios anything that they have to concentrate on picking up and eating. 5. You will have to walk up and down the aisles a few times with a child this age. Expect to...
